Can someone help me stat-out an Eastern-style dragon wormling?

I have an idea for a lair filled with wing-less Eastern-style dragons, most only 2' long, but a few up to 6' long. So I need help creating a Hatchling and an Adolescent.

I'd use something like this.. PS: Since they're dragons, I'd expect them to be stronger than their size would suggest.
Hatchling
HP 2d6, init +1, CA 11+2(nat);
Att +3 Bite 1d5+1;
Act 1d20;
TS : Base as Warrior lvl 2; add Fort +0 ,Will +1, Ref +1;
Mov 30', climb 20';
Adolescent
HP 3d6+3, init +1, CA 11+3(nat);
Att +4; Bite 1d7+1, Claw 1d4+1 (roll twice, keep highest);
Act 2d20;
TS : Base as Warrior lvl 3; add Fort +1, Will +1, Ref +1;
Mov 30', climb 20';
